131 - SPARK - Stop Treating Grades as Wages 01.03.2020

Here’s what happens when we treat grades as wages: 1️⃣ Teachers try to grade EVERYTHING 2️⃣ Teachers feel compelled to give marks for effort 3️⃣ Teachers put zeroes in gradebooks 4️⃣ Quantity > quality 5️⃣ Bonus marks distort the assessment picture Welcome to SPARKS: mini-segments intended to spark your thinking and ignite your practice.
